Usuário com melhor resposta
VERIFICAR SE O BOTÃO FOI CLICADO

Pergunta
-
Olá, sou iniciante e gostaria de saber como executar o comando para verificar se o botão foi clicado.
Gostaria de saber como solucionar ...
Gostaria que o evento acontecesse ao clicar no BOTÃO 1 >
Se o botão 2 for clicado e também for digitado algum texto no textBox1 > continuar para o form 3
Se não mostrar a mensagem > Your avatar was not found.
using System; using System.Collections.Generic; using System.ComponentModel; using System.Data; using System.Drawing; using System.Linq; using System.Text; using System.Threading.Tasks; using System.Windows.Forms; namespace HABBO { public partial class Form2 : Form { public int i; public Form2() { InitializeComponent(); } private void button2_Click(object sender, EventArgs e) { webBrowser1.Navigate("www.habbo.com.br/habbo-imaging/avatarimage?img_format=gif&user=" + textBox1.Text + "&action=std&direction=4&head_direction=4&gesture=std&size=l"); textBox1.Enabled = true; button1.Enabled = true; } private void Form2_Load(object sender, EventArgs e) { } private void timer1_Tick(object sender, EventArgs e) { if (i <= progressBar1.Maximum) { progressBar1.Value = i; i = i + 1; } else { timer1.Enabled = false; this.Visible = false; Form3 frm3 = new Form3(); frm3.Show(); } } private void button1_Click(object sender, EventArgs e) { if ((textBox1.TextLength > 0) && VERIFICAR SE O BOTÃO 2 FOI CLICADO.) { timer1.Enabled = true; } else MessageBox.Show("Your avatar was not found."); } } }
- Editado Gabriel Castilho Oliveira terça-feira, 26 de junho de 2018 16:51
Respostas
-
Olá, você pode criar um objeto do tipo INT onde neste você o preenche toda vez que clicarem no botão 2, e no método do button1_Click você verifica usando esse IF
if (!string.IsNullOrEmpty(textBox1.Text) && Botao2Clicado > 0) {}
Lembre-se de criar a variável antes, int Botao2Clicado = 0;
private void button2_Click(object sender, EventArgs e)
{
webBrowser1.Navigate("www.habbo.com.br/habbo-imaging/avatarimage?img_format=gif&user=" + textBox1.Text + "&action=std&direction=4&head_direction=4&gesture=std&size=l");
textBox1.Enabled = true;
button1.Enabled = true;
BotaoClicado += 1;
}
Abs!
Leandro de Agostini MCTS - Web Application, Framework 4
- Sugerido como Resposta Junin incipiente quarta-feira, 27 de junho de 2018 17:17
- Marcado como Resposta Filipe B CastroModerator sexta-feira, 3 de agosto de 2018 19:40
Todas as Respostas
-
Olá, você pode criar um objeto do tipo INT onde neste você o preenche toda vez que clicarem no botão 2, e no método do button1_Click você verifica usando esse IF
if (!string.IsNullOrEmpty(textBox1.Text) && Botao2Clicado > 0) {}
Lembre-se de criar a variável antes, int Botao2Clicado = 0;
private void button2_Click(object sender, EventArgs e)
{
webBrowser1.Navigate("www.habbo.com.br/habbo-imaging/avatarimage?img_format=gif&user=" + textBox1.Text + "&action=std&direction=4&head_direction=4&gesture=std&size=l");
textBox1.Enabled = true;
button1.Enabled = true;
BotaoClicado += 1;
}
Abs!
Leandro de Agostini MCTS - Web Application, Framework 4
- Sugerido como Resposta Junin incipiente quarta-feira, 27 de junho de 2018 17:17
- Marcado como Resposta Filipe B CastroModerator sexta-feira, 3 de agosto de 2018 19:40
-
Boa tarde,
Por falta de retorno essa thread está sendo encerrada.
Se necessário favor abrir uma nova thread.
Atenciosamente,Filipe B de Castro
Esse conteúdo é fornecido sem garantias de qualquer tipo, seja expressa ou implícita
MSDN Community Support
Por favor, lembre-se de Marcar como Resposta as postagens que resolveram o seu problema. Essa é uma maneira comum de reconhecer aqueles que o ajudaram e fazer com que seja mais fácil para os outros visitantes encontrarem a resolução mais tarde.